Trisilane, 1,1,1,3,3,3-hexamethyl-2-phenyl-2-[(trimethylsilyl)ethynyl]-, is a complex organosilicon compound characterized by its unique molecular structure. It features a trisilane core, which consists of three silicon atoms bonded together, with each silicon atom connected to various substituents. The compound is further adorned with a phenyl group and an ethynyl group, which is itself attached to a trimethylsilyl moiety. This intricate arrangement of atoms and functional groups endows the compound with specific chemical properties and potential applications in the fields of materials science and organic synthesis. Its hexamethyl and trimethylsilyl groups contribute to its stability and reactivity, making it a subject of interest for researchers exploring the properties and reactions of organosilicon compounds.

PHOTOLYSIS OF ORGANOPOLYSILANES. PHOTOCHEMICAL FORMATION AND REACTIONS OF 1-TRIMETHYLSILYL-1-PHENYL-1-SILACYCLOPROPENE DERIVATIVES

Ishikawa, Mitsuo,Nakagawa, Ken-Ichi,Kumada, Makoto

, p. 117 - 128 (2007/10/02)

The photolysis of tris(trimethylsilyl)phenylsilane (I) in the presence of 1-hexyne, 3,3-dimethyl-1-butyne, trimethylsilylacetylene, 3-hexyne, 1-trimethylsilylpropyne, 1,2-bis(trimethylsilyl)acetylene and 2,2,5,5-tetramethyl-3-hexyne afforded the respective silacyclopropenes.The silacyclopropenes produced from monosubstituted acetylenes underwent photochemical isomerization to give disilanylacetylene derivatives, via a 1,2-hydrogen shift in the silacyclopropene ring.Irradiation of I in the presence of 3-hexyne, 1-trimethylsilylpropyne or 2,2,5,5-tetramethyl-3-hexyne gave the corresponding silacyclopropenes which could be isolated by preparative GLC.The silacyclopropene from 1,2-bis(trimethylsilyl)acetylene, however, readily underwent thermal rearrangement to give trimethylsilylacetylene via a 1,2-trimethylsilyl shift.This type of rearrangement was also found in the photochemical process.
